You Gotta Go There to Come Back is Stereophonics' fourth album, released on V2 in 2003. It became their third consecutive album to top the UK chart selling 101,946 copies in its first week. It was the final Stereophonics album with long-time original drummer the late Stuart Cable.
The album shows a newly found maturity compared to the brazenness of the previous three.The album is also darker and slightly more bleak than the band's previous albums, certain songs and lyrics reflect the personal problems and feelings of the bands frontman Kelly Jones. After this mature album they returned to the sound of their previous albums with their next album. The title can also be explained by this statement: they had to go here, and record this album, to come back and return to their more indie rock and alternative rock sound.
